Checking your requests

It takes time for us to retrieve your request: learn more about the Library's collection delivery service

Once logged in, your "Requests" page lists items requested, available for collection, and recent historic requests (going back approximately one week). Click the "Requests" link near the top right corner of the page to access this information:

-

For quick reference, the site also displays request summary information on every page, just below the "Requests" link:

-

The requests summary page lets you quickly see which requests are currently being processed, which items are available for collection, as well as requests made during the previous week:

-

The pickup location is clearly listed, along with an area for any notes Library staff may have entered regarding your request. For any item in these lists, click the title to visit the record display page.
